* feat(admin): align turnstone-admin DB config with server (config.toml + env) turnstone-admin previously read TURNSTONE_DB_* env vars only, forcing operators with credentials in config.toml to re-export them just to run admin commands. Wire add_config_arg + apply_config(["database"]) into main() so admin honors the same precedence as turnstone-server: CLI / config.toml [database] > TURNSTONE_DB_* env > hardcoded defaults. Also exposes pool_size + sslmode/sslrootcert/sslcert/sslkey to admin, which previously dropped any such config silently. Hardening: load_config() now warns once when config.toml is group- or world-readable, since DB password and TLS key paths live in [database]. Tests cover precedence (default / config / env / partial fallback / empty-string-in-config-beats-env), the real init_storage boundary on a tmp sqlite path, the sys.argv -> main() pre-parser path, and the new permission check (mode 0644 warns, 0600 quiet). * test(admin): unify config import style in test_admin_db_config Use module alias (config_mod.apply_config) instead of mixing 'import turnstone.core.config as config_mod' with 'from turnstone.core.config import apply_config'. Addresses github-code-quality bot feedback on PR #531.
